4 Tips For The Best Baby Images

Control of ones subject allows a photographer to capture the best photo. Having the ability to change lighting, location, lenses, camera settings, and the subjects of the photo are what allow for this control. Mood and pose of the subjects lend even greater control.

Babies are an entirely different subject. All control over them is simply gone. They are tiny little people yet it is they that control how the shoot goes from start to finish. It is the photographers job here to simply capture the most memorable baby images that naturally occur. Use the following tips for photographing the ever changing moods and poses of babies.

1) Get personal

We adults have this “bubble” of comfortability that babies do not have. When getting a baby image you can fully enter there world and get up close and personal with the camera. Of course do this within reason, not frightening or upsetting the baby. If the baby is unfamiliar with a camera lens then you may need to stay back and “get close” by zooming in. Try using a wide angle lens to see the world from the babies perspective.

2) Notice Everything

Babies do everything for a reason and with a purpose at this age. Notice and capture every little movement. These tiny movements can make the best baby pictures images.

3) Be Comfortable

To keep the baby content and avoid frustration keep the setting familiar to him or her. Having the photo shoot in the family home, or the babies bedroom would be a good idea. Studios work well if your able to keep the baby occupied with things like toys. At all costs have the parents bring some items the baby knows from home as well. A blanket or stuffed animal are perfect.

4) Snap It Fast

The opportune time often comes when your not expecting it so ensure you have the camera set to burst mode or continuous shooting mode. Taking multiple shots in rapid succession to capture a baby image can lead to some great shots. This will allow for some great choosing of photos later on.
